Description
Sall4 is a probable transcription factor. Defects in Sall4 are the cause of Okihiro syndrome; also known as Duane radial ray syndrome (DRRS). It is a disorder characterized by the association of forearm malformations with Duane retraction syndrome. Sall4 is also involved in forelimb and heart development in mice.
